Gemini Enterprise Agent Platform
Gemini Enterprise Agent Platform is an advanced AI infrastructure from Google Cloud that enables organizations to build and manage intelligent agents at scale. As the evolution of Vertex AI, it consolidates model development, agent creation, and deployment into a unified platform. The system provides access to a diverse library of over 200 AI models, including cutting-edge Gemini models and leading third-party solutions. It supports both low-code and full-code development, giving teams flexibility in how they design and deploy agents. With capabilities like Agent Runtime, organizations can run high-performance agents that handle long-duration tasks and complex workflows. The Memory Bank feature allows agents to retain long-term context, improving personalization and decision-making. Security is a core focus, with tools like Agent Identity, Registry, and Gateway ensuring compliance, traceability, and controlled access. The platform also integrates seamlessly with enterprise systems, enabling agents to connect with data sources, applications, and operational tools. Real-time monitoring and observability features provide visibility into agent reasoning and execution. Simulation and evaluation tools allow teams to test and refine agents before and after deployment. Automated optimization further enhances agent performance by identifying issues and suggesting improvements. The platform supports multi-agent orchestration, enabling agents to collaborate and complete complex tasks efficiently. Overall, it transforms AI from a productivity tool into a fully autonomous operational capability for modern enterprises.

FrontFace
FrontFace is an advanced on-premise software solution for digital signage and kiosks that provides a straightforward way to set up interactive terminals, touchscreen interfaces, and static public displays for various applications, including advertising and information dissemination. It supports a wide range of media formats, allowing you to showcase text, images, PDFs, videos, news tickers, and even complete web pages using HTML5. The standout feature is that you can generate high-definition content using any Windows application that has printing capabilities, enabling you to utilize familiar programs like PowerPoint, Word, and Excel without the need to master a new, complicated design tool. Additionally, FrontFace offers a plugin interface that enhances its functionality by allowing the integration of external calendars such as Office 365 Exchange Online, ICS, or Excel, as well as specialized applications like accident statistics boards or dashboards. Moreover, managing content with FrontFace is incredibly user-friendly and requires no programming expertise, making it accessible to everyone. This combination of features positions FrontFace as an exceptionally versatile choice for anyone seeking to implement digital signage solutions.

NSwag
NSwag is a powerful toolchain specifically designed for managing Swagger/OpenAPI versions 2.0 and 3.0, catering to environments such as .NET, .NET Core, ASP.NET Core, and TypeScript, and it is built using C#. This utility allows developers to generate OpenAPI specifications from their existing API controllers and subsequently produce client code based on those specifications. By integrating the features usually found in both Swashbuckle for OpenAPI/Swagger creation and AutoRest for client code generation, NSwag simplifies the entire process into an efficient and cohesive toolchain. Key features include the generation of both Swagger 2.0 and OpenAPI 3.0 specifications directly from C# ASP.NET (Core) controllers, the ability to serve these specifications through ASP.NET (Core) middleware with integrated options like Swagger UI or ReDoc, and the functionality to create C# or TypeScript clients or proxies from the generated specifications. Additionally, NSwag offers various usage options, such as an intuitive graphical interface called NSwagStudio, command-line tools compatible with Windows, Mac, and Linux, and smooth integration into C# projects via NuGet packages, making it a flexible choice for developers. The extensive capabilities of NSwag not only streamline API development but also enhance the overall process of client generation, proving to be an invaluable asset for developers looking to optimize their workflow. With the continuous evolution of APIs, having a tool like NSwag at one’s disposal can greatly improve the speed and quality of development efforts.

Payload CMS
Payload is an adaptable, open-source backend and headless CMS built on Next.js, enabling teams to consolidate their technology stack and develop a range of applications, from content-rich websites to headless e-commerce solutions, enterprise platforms, and digital asset management systems, all within a cohesive and customizable environment. Developers can quickly initiate new projects by using npx create-payload-app, configure schemas with fully typed JavaScript, and seamlessly create REST APIs optimized for any compatible database adapter. On the other hand, marketers appreciate the elegant and user-friendly admin interface that simplifies visual editing, offers live previews, supports localization, provides multi-tenancy features, allows for white-label branding, and implements nuanced access controls, all while integrating authentication and delivering real-time RAG-ready vector embeddings effortlessly. Furthermore, Payload enhances its appeal to enterprises with advanced functionalities such as Single Sign-On (SSO) for streamlined user access, AI-driven auto-embedding capabilities, static A/B testing to refine performance, and customizable publishing workflows to improve content management processes. This comprehensive set of features ensures that Payload is not only a powerful tool but also an excellent choice for teams aiming to elevate their digital footprint and drive innovation in their projects. Ultimately, Payload's robust architecture and user-centric design make it a standout option for those seeking to optimize their content management and application development efforts.
